Where To Get The Cheapest Gas For Labor Day Weekend In Alexandria

Gas prices have fallen over the last month but are significantly more than a year ago.

If you're getting in one last summer trip over Labor Day weekend, perhaps you want to plan ahead and know the more affordable places to fill up your tank. Depending on where you're going, getting gas in Alexandria could be the better option.

Alexandria is on the higher end of the state for gas prices, according to AAA data. The city's average price of $2.895 per gallon for Wednesday, Aug. 29 sits above Fairfax County's $2.854, Falls Church City's $2.807 and Arlington County's $2.791.

Alexandria area prices dropped slightly from $2.910 last month but are higher than last year's $2.432. That doesn't mean there aren't good options in Alexandria going into the holiday weekend. AAA's price map shows prices as low as $2.67 for Wednesday.

If you're driving elsewhere in Virginia, you'll find prices more in the $2.50 range once you leave the DC region. The average gas price in Northern Virginia is $2.720, up from $2.329 a year ago, according to AAA. Prices in Maryland and DC are higher: $2.788 and $3007, respectively.

Nationwide, gas prices dropped two cents from last month to $2.84, but this is still 48 cents more than this time last year.

"With Labor Day approaching, motorists could see a small swing towards higher gas prices, but any jump should not last past the holiday weekend," said AAA spokesperson Jeanette Casselano in a statement.
